During his college years, his passion for the performing arts blossomed, leading him to star in prominent stage dramas like Aanaiyidungal Anna and Udhaya Suriyan . He later moved to Chennai (then Madras) with intentions of joining a medical college, but destiny pivoted him toward the glitz and glamour of the silver screen.
